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
43819 19687 3160 02797235019
5852883297 7380335104 025236
5852883297 7380335104 025236
49265 6976939031 890325 236674
All about undefined
Interested in learning more?
5852883297 7380335104 025236
49265 6976939031 890325 236674
See more
25 0521812836
858585524 94543 574869
See more
71 36510 4061
4827 6726483784 471 230702929
See more